      Remo Berre has adopted a flexible and changeable offensive and defensive strategy. They can adjust their offensive and defensive focus according to the game situation. Their players in the front field are actively involved in running and interspersing, and their pulling tactics have achieved remarkable results. In the recent ten matches, the team has an average of 24.8 effective attacks per game. Their success rate of breakthroughs on the flanks is stable, allowing them to continuously put tactical pressure on the opponent's penalty area. However, there are still some flaws in the team's defensive details. The speed of their back - defending and advancing on the flanks is relatively slow. When facing the opponent's continuous flank attacks and through - balls into the channels between the full - backs and centre - backs, the defensive line is prone to problems such as out - of - position and delayed filling.       Raymundo Alemão has been in solid form at home recently. In their last six home games, they've secured three wins, one draw, and two losses, marking a 50% win - rate. They average 1.16 goals scored and 1.00 goals conceded per game, with well - balanced offensive and defensive stats and a positive goal difference of +1. Their average of 5.3 corner kicks per home game is significantly higher than the league average, indicating a strong set - piece strategy. Additionally, they receive an average of 1.2 yellow cards per game, suggesting a moderate defensive intensity. On the other hand, Vitória has impressive overall league statistics, boasting a 70% win - rate and an average of 2.0 goals per game, placing them among the top in terms of offensive firepower. However, their away form is a concern. In their last five away games, they've only won two, a 40% win - rate.       Rumo Belém has shown a balanced offensive and defensive performance at home recently. In their last six home games, they've achieved three wins, one draw, and two losses, averaging 1.17 goals scored and 1.17 goals conceded per match. Their defensive stability is quite prominent. Looking at the details, they defeated São Paulo 1 - 0 at home, lost to Athletico Paranaense 1 - 2, drew 1 - 1 with Palmeiras, beat Bahia 2 - 1, overcame Galvez 2 - 1, and lost to Cruzeiro 0 - 1. The team averages 5.33 corner kicks per home game, indicating their active involvement in set - piece tactics. On the other hand, Vitória's away form has been consistently poor. They've lost all of their last four away games. Although they average 1.75 goals scored per game, they concede 2.25 goals, showing that while their attack is potent, there are significant defensive flaws.
